We manage a Regenerative Farm with Beef, Sheep, Pigs, and Chickens. After 40 years of growing chickens for the big corporations, we now raise our own animals in a way that provides the best quality meat possible. Without all those chickens around we can share spots of our paridse with others. We have a Glamping tent set up and RV sites available too.The RV site has a great view of sunrise over the Chilhowee Mountains. You will see our flock of sheep and the herd of cows while enjoying your stay. We are very close to the Ocoee River for the adventurous or the Hiwassee for those who may want to float and relax. There are so many Hiking trails nearby for anyone, we rank them from easy to extreme.
